Practical Checks Before Launching Your Campaign
- Test with your brand color palette: Does it harmonize or clash when placed over your primary colors?
- Preview on mobile screens: Check readability and impact when scaled down for mobile social media graphics.
- Check black and white usage: How does it hold up if printed in a single color on a promo item?
- Pair with different fonts: Test it alongside a sleek sans serif, a traditional serif, a playful script, and a bold display font to find the best pairing for your brand identity.
- Review spacing and balance: Place it inside real editorial design mockups, like a newsletter header, to ensure it doesn’t overwhelm other elements.
- Confirm commercial licensing: Before using in paid campaigns or client work, verify the license covers your intended commercial design use.
- Compare against competitor visuals: Does it help you stand out or blend in within your niche?
